The Evolution of Technology
Technology has a long and fascinating history, beginning with simple tools and evolving into complex systems that shape our modern world. Early humans developed tools for hunting, farming, and survival, which laid the foundation for innovation. The Industrial Revolution marked a significant turning point, introducing machinery, mechanized production, and transportation innovations that reshaped societies and economies. The 20th century brought the rise of computers, telecommunications, and the internet, connecting the world like never before. Today, emerging technologies such as artificial intelligence, robotics, and blockchain are driving a new era of digital transformation.

Artificial Intelligence and Machine Learning
Artificial intelligence (AI) is one of the most transformative technologies today. AI and machine learning systems analyze vast amounts of data to recognize patterns, make predictions, and automate tasks. Applications of AI include virtual assistants, autonomous vehicles, predictive analytics, cybersecurity, and healthcare diagnostics. Machine learning improves efficiency by optimizing processes and offering actionable insights. As AI technology advances, ethical considerations, transparency, and responsible usage become critical for ensuring positive societal outcomes.
Cybersecurity in a Digital World
As technology becomes increasingly integrated into daily life, cybersecurity has emerged as a vital concern. Protecting sensitive information from hackers, cyberattacks, and digital threats is essential for individuals, businesses, and governments. Cybersecurity measures include encryption, secure networks, multi-factor authentication, and constant monitoring. Organizations must continually adapt to evolving cyber threats to maintain trust and safety in the digital ecosystem. Awareness, education, and investment in security infrastructure are critical for safeguarding the technological world we rely on.
The Internet of Things
The Internet of Things (IoT) connects devices, systems, and infrastructure to the internet, enabling intelligent automation and data-driven insights. Smart homes, wearable fitness devices, connected vehicles, and industrial sensors enhance convenience, safety, and efficiency. IoT technology allows real-time monitoring and predictive maintenance, reducing downtime and costs. While IoT offers numerous benefits, it also presents challenges related to data privacy, security, and integration that must be carefully managed.
